How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al Works

With fire sprinkler discharge water removal, the process is often misunderstood. Many homeowners think they can handle the cleanup themselves, but the truth is, DIY methods often lead to further damage and costly repairs. By hiring a professional like our team, you can avoid these pitfalls and ensure that your property is restored to its original condition. Our process involves the following key steps:

Step 1: Assessment and Documentation

Our team will arrive on-site to assess the damage and document the extent of the water damage using high-tech equipment. This will help us find out the best course of action for removal and repair. We’ll identify any hidden areas of damage and provide a detailed report to share with your insurance company.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Using our powerful truck-mounted extractors, we’ll remove as much water as possible from the affected area. This is a critical step in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th. We’ll target hard-to-reach areas and use specialized equipment to extract water from carpets, upholstery, and other surfaces.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Next, we’ll use our high-tech drying systems to remove any remaining moisture from the affected area. This includes using dehumidifiers and fans to circulate air and speed up the drying process. We’ll monitor the area’s humidity levels and adjust our equipment as needed to ensure the job is done correctly.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Once the area is dry, our team will use specialized cleaning solutions to remove any dirt, grime, or bacteria that may have accumulated during the water damage. We’ll also use sanitizing agents to kill any remaining microorganisms and prevent future growth.

Step 5: Final Inspections and Reporting

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that the area is completely dry and free of any remaining moisture. We’ll provide a detailed report to share with your insurance company, including photos and documentation of the work completed. We’ll also provide recommendations for any more repairs or maintenance to prevent future water damage.

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Water damage is widespread (multiple rooms affected) No Yes The job is too complex and needs specialized equipment and expertise.
You’re not sure what type of water damage you’re dealing with (freshwater vs. Blackwater) No Yes Blackwater damage needs specialized handling and equipment to prevent health risks.
The water damage is hidden (behind walls or under flooring) No Yes Hidden dam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to detect and repair.
The affected area is large (over 1,000 square feet) No Yes The job is too big and needs a team of experienced professionals to complete efficiently.
You’re unsure how to document the damage for insurance purposes No Yes Proper documentation is crucial for a smooth insurance claims process.

Q: What is the IICRC certification, and why is it important?

A: The IICRC (Institute of Inspection, Cleaning and Restoration Certification) is a non-profit organization that sets standards for the restoration industry.
